Daft Punk Campaign

MORE DEFT THAN DAFT: A few examples from Columbia's inspired, multimedia teaser campaign for the forthcoming Daft Punk album (and its viral offshoots), as chronicled in the label's Daft Punk Post: billboards, mash-ups (notably a pulsing blend of DP with Justin Timberlake's "Suit & Tie"), "Disco Is Alive" snipes, fan Tumblrs, tweeted rumors at SXSW, Internet meme pics of the new Pope (with the ubiquitous DP helmet) and a fan tattoo.
